Title edit: added that it is a summary of his show
Journalism and Analysis from an Anti-imperialist Perspective
You must log in or register to comment.
Pinned to his twitter page:
Sick of the warmongering lies of the Western media?
Are you looking for a genuine leftist perspective on Russia, China, and the emerging multipolar world?
Consider supporting The Left Lens on Patreon to help sustain independent media in 2023 and beyond!